Webb8 mars 2024 · The freezing of pizza dough is not as straightforward as knowing how to store pizza dough in airtight containers in the fridge but it’s still a pretty simple process. … WebbThere are generally two ‘risings’ that happen in bread making. The first is known as ‘ bulk fermentation ’ which is allowing your dough to expand in the bowl, the second is ‘proofing’ which is the last stage done in the tin before it goes into the oven. Generally you want to be bulk fermenting your bread for around 1.5 - 2 hours and proofing your bread for around 1 …
